Abu Dhabi Aviation Reports $59 Million Profit in Q1 2025

Abu Dhabi Aviation Company announced a significant increase in net profits for the first quarter of 2025, reaching AED 215.32 million, compared to AED 26.81 million during the same period in 2024. Emirates Airline Sees No Impact from US Tariffs, Remains Cautious

Emirates Airline has reported that it has not experienced any impact from the tariffs imposed by US President Donald Trump. However, the airline remains vigilant due to ongoing uncertainties in the market, according to Deputy President and Chief Commercial Officer Adnan Kazim. Dubai International Airport to Close as Operations Shift to Al Maktoum International Airport

Dubai International Airport (DXB) is set to close once all operations transition to Al Maktoum International Airport, also known as Dubai World Central (DWC), according to Paul Griffiths, the CEO of Dubai Airports. 15% Growth in Private Aviation Movement at Dubai South in Q1 2025

Dubai South’s Mohammed Bin Rashid Aviation project has reported a significant increase in private aviation movement during the first quarter of 2025, recording a total of 5 275 flights.
